Ingredients for Pineapple Upside Down Cake
- 1 box (15.25 oz) yellow cake mix
- 1/2 c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, softened
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 1 (20 oz) can pineapple slices, drained
- 1/4 cup packed light brown sugar
- 1/4 cup granulated sugar
- 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
- 1/2 teaspoon ground nutmeg
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 2 large eggs
- 1/2 cup milk

Step-by-Step Preparation: Recipe For Pineapple Upside Down Cake Using Cake Mix
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ease and flour a 9-inch round cake pan.
- In a large bowl, combine cake mix, eggs, and milk. Mix until just combined. Avoid overmixing.
- Melt butter in a saucepan. Stir in granulated sugar and brown sugar. Cook until sugar dissolves.
- Arrange pineapple slices in the prepared pan. Sprinkle with cinnamon, nutmeg, and salt.
- Pour batter evenly over pineapple. Bake for 30-35 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
- Let the cake cool completely in the pan before inverting onto a serving plate.
Tips & Troubleshooting, Recipe For Pineapple Upside Down Cake Using Cake Mix
If the cake is browning too quickly, cover the edges with aluminum foil. For a crispier topping, reduce the baking time by a few minutes. If the cake is still wet after baking, increase the baking time slightly.
Variations and Serving Suggestions
Explore thoroughly the possibilities for customization. Consider adding chopped walnuts or pecans to the topping for added texture and flavor. A dollop of whipped cream or a scoop of vanilla ice cream makes a delightful complement. This versatile dessert can be enjoyed for breakfast, brunch, or any time you desire a sweet treat.

Clarifying Questions
How long does it take to prepare this cake?
Preparation time is relatively quick, around 20-30 minutes, depending on the specific steps you choose to incorporate. The baking time itself is crucial to the final outcome, and can range from 30-40 minutes. The total time will depend on these factors.
What type of cake mix works best for this recipe?
A yellow or vanilla cake mix will yield optimal results. Feel free to experiment with other flavors for a unique touch. However, a traditional cake mix is generally the most straightforward choice.
Can I use fresh pineapple instead of canned?
Yes, fresh pineapple can be used. However, it’s important to adjust the preparation time to ensure the pineapple is cooked sufficiently. Also, fresh pineapple requires careful preparation and can affect the overall outcome.
What is the best way to store the cake?
Store the cake in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days. For longer storage, refrigeration is recommended, but be mindful of condensation that can affect the cake’s texture. Proper storage is key to preserving the quality and flavor.
